Disease muscular dystrophy is a disease characterized by weakness and deterioration of skeletal muscle. There are more than 30 different forms of muscular dystrophy, but the two most common are Duchenne and Becker muscular dystrophy (Baronceri). These two forms of disease are sexually related, and mainly affect men. Muscular dystrophy is a degenerative disease in which skeletal muscle degenerates, loses its power, and leads to increased disability and deformity. The muscles attached to the bone by the tendons are responsible for the movement inside the body, but in the muscular atrophy, the muscles gradually weaken. When the muscle fibers become very fragile, they begin to die and are replaced with connective tissue. The connective tissue is fibrous and fatty, not muscle
